What is the difference between Junior Data Protection Analyst vs Data Privacy Specialist?

AspectJunior Data Protection AnalystData Privacy Specialist
CertificationsBasic data protection and privacy certifications (e.g., CIPP/US, CIPM)Similar certifications, often more advanced or specialized
Work EnvironmentEntry-level role, supporting data protection initiatives within organizationsFocused on privacy compliance, policy development, and risk assessment
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in tech, finance, healthcare sectorsUsed across industries with strong privacy regulations
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level data protection rolesClarifying privacy compliance responsibilities

The Junior Data Protection Analyst typically handles foundational data protection tasks, supporting compliance efforts. In contrast, a Data Privacy Specialist often focuses on developing privacy policies and ensuring regulatory adherence. Both roles require similar certifications and are prevalent in regulated industries, but they differ in scope and seniority.

About Us
With over 50 years of experience, DTCC is the premier post-trade market infrastructure for the global financial services industry. From 20 locations around the world, DTCC, through its subsidiaries, automates, centralizes, and standardizes the processing of financial transactions, mitigating risk, increasing transparency, enhancing performance and driving efficiency for thousands of broker/dealers, custodian banks and asset managers. Industry owned and governed, the firm innovates purposefully, simplifying the complexities of clearing, settlement, asset servicing, transaction processing, trade reporting and data services across asset classes, bringing enhanced resilience and soundness to existing financial markets while advancing the digital asset ecosystem. In 2024, DTCC's subsidiaries processed securities transactions valued at U.S. $3.7 quadrillion and its depository subsidiary provided custody and asset servicing for securities issues from over 150 countries and territories valued at U.S. $99 trillion. DTCC's Global Trade Repository service, through locally registered, licensed, or approved trade repositories, processes more than 25 billion messages annually.
